How Sewage Water Extraction Works
Our team follows a meticulous process to ensure that every aspect of the job is handled with care and precision. We start by assessing the situation and identifying the source of the problem. From there, we’ll use specialized equipment to extract the sewage water and dry out the affected area. Our crew will also disinfect and deodorize the space to prevent bacterial growth and lingering odors. Throughout the process, we’ll keep you informed and work closely with your insurance company to ensure a seamless claims process.
Step 1: Assessment and Containment
Our team will assess the situation and identify the source of the problem. We’ll contain the affected area to prevent further damage and ensure a safe working environment.
Step 2: Sewage Water Extraction
We’ll use specialized equipment to extract the sewage water and remove any debris or contaminants.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Our crew will use industrial-grade drying equipment to dry out the affected area and prevent further moisture damage.
Step 4: Disinfection and Deodorization
We’ll disinfect and deodorize the space to prevent bacterial growth and lingering odors.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Report
Our team will conduct a final inspection to ensure that the job is complete and the area is safe for occupancy. We’ll provide a detailed report for your insurance adjuster and ensure a smooth claims process.

Sewage Water Extraction Cost in Grand Prairie, TX
The cost of sewage water extraction can vary depending on the severity of the situation,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Grand Prairie, TX. Our team will provide a detailed estimate based on your specific situation. Keep in mind that prices can range from $500 to $2,500 or more, depending on the scope of the job.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Sewage Water Ext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Severity of the situation, size of the affected area, and local conditions. |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$200 – $1,000 | Size of the affected area and type of equipment needed. |
| Disinfection and Deodorization | $100 – $500 | Type of disinfectant and deodorizer used. |
| Final Inspection and Report | $100 – $300 | Complexity of the job and type of report required. |
| Emergency Service Fee | $200 – $500 | Time of day and urgency of the situation. |
| Travel Fee | $50 – $100 | Distance from our location to your property. |
